-UNITED STATES NUCLEAR REGULATORY COMMISSION DOCKET NO. 50-312 SACRAMENTO MUNICIPAL UTILITY DISTRICT NOTICE OF ISSUANCE OF AMENDMENT 0 FACILITY OPERATIriG LICEf45E The U. S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(the Commission) has issued
- Amendment No.-24 to Facility Operating License No. DPR-54 issued to Sacramento Municipal Utility District, which revised Technical Specifica-tions for operation of the Rancho Seco Nuclear Generating Station, located in' Sacramento County, California.
The amendment is effective as of its date of. issuance.
This amendment revises the administrative controls portion of the Technical Specifications to reflect a revised plant organization structure and clarify the review requirements for changes to the Security and Emergency Plans and their implementing procedures.
-The application for the amendment complies with the standards and requirements of the Atomic Energy Act of 1954, as amendt ' (theAct),and the Commission's rules and regulations.
The Commission has made appropriate findings as. required by the Act and the Commission's rules and regulations in 10 CFR Chapter I, which are~ set forth in the license amendment.
Prior-public notice,of this' amendment was not required since the amendment does
. not involve:a significant-huards consideration.
ThelCommission has determined-that the issuance of this amendment-wilitnot' result in any significant environmental impact and that pursuant
